As a homeowner looking to revamp my bedroom, the idea of creating a cozy green and beige space has intrigued me. The calming and earthy tones of green and beige can truly transform a room into a tranquil sanctuary. Here’s how I went about incorporating these colors into my bedroom:
Choosing the Right Shades
For a harmonious color scheme, I opted for soft sage green and warm beige tones. These colors complement each other beautifully and create a relaxing atmosphere in the room.
Incorporating Colors into the Space
I painted one accent wall in a soft sage green hue and kept the rest of the walls in a neutral beige shade. I added green and beige throw pillows, a cozy beige area rug, and green curtains to tie the colors together.
Lighting for Ambiance
I chose warm, soft lighting fixtures like bedside lamps and string lights to enhance the cozy ambiance of the room. The gentle glow of the lights adds to the overall comfort of the space.
Patterns and Textures
To add depth to the room, I incorporated subtle patterns like a green geometric throw blanket and textured beige bedding. These elements create visual interest without overwhelming the space.
Bringing in Greenery
I placed a few potted plants around the room to introduce natural elements and fresh air. The touch of greenery adds life to the space and complements the green and beige color palette.
Style Choices
For a minimalist look, I kept the furniture simple and clean-lined, focusing on the green and beige color scheme. However, I added a few eclectic touches like a vintage green armchair for character.
Budget-Friendly Tips
To achieve the cozy green and beige look on a budget, I shopped for second-hand furniture and accessories, repurposed existing items with a fresh coat of paint, and DIYed some decor pieces like green plant pots.
By following these steps and infusing my personal style into the design, I was able to create a cozy green and beige bedroom that feels like a peaceful retreat every time I walk in. The combination of green and beige hues has truly transformed my space into a place of relaxation and serenity.

In a world where green and beige bedrooms are often associated with tranquility and harmony, why not challenge the status quo and create a space that sparks debate and intrigue? Here are 12 bold and unconventional ideas to transform your green and beige bedroom into a conversation starter:
1. **Olive and Mustard**: Instead of traditional shades of green and beige, opt for olive green walls and mustard yellow accents for a daring color scheme that demands attention.
2. **Industrial Chic**: Combine raw, unfinished materials like exposed brick walls and metal accents with green and beige furniture for an edgy industrial vibe.
3. **Gothic Glam**: Embrace the dark side with black walls and deep green and beige textiles for a luxurious yet mysterious atmosphere.
4. **Neon Pop**: Add neon green and beige accents to a predominantly black and white color scheme for a modern and energetic look.
5. **Bohemian Rhapsody**: Mix vibrant green and beige textiles with eclectic patterns and textures for a bohemian-inspired bedroom that exudes creativity.
6. **Art Deco Elegance**: Incorporate geometric patterns and metallic accents in shades of green and beige for a glamorous Art Deco-inspired bedroom.
7. **Minimalist Zen**: Keep the color palette simple with light green and beige tones, clean lines, and minimalistic furniture for a serene and calming space.
8. **Tropical Paradise**: Bring the outdoors in with lush greenery, sandy beige accents, and tropical prints for a vibrant and exotic bedroom.
9. **Vintage Eclecticism**: Blend vintage green and beige furniture with quirky accessories and retro patterns for a whimsical and eclectic bedroom.
10. **Scandinavian Serenity**: Embrace the Scandinavian design aesthetic with light green walls, beige textiles, and natural wood accents for a cozy and understated bedroom.
11. **Rustic Retreat**: Pair earthy green and beige tones with distressed wood furniture and cozy textiles for a rustic and inviting bedroom.
12. **Futuristic Fusion**: Combine futuristic elements like metallic surfaces and neon lights with green and beige accents for a cutting-edge and avant-garde bedroom.
By daring to defy convention and embracing unconventional ideas, you can create a green and beige bedroom that not only reflects your unique personality but also challenges the norms of traditional design.
